- Munz_Lakes abstract "Munz Lakes is a lake located directly on the San Andreas Fault in the northern Sierra Pelona Mountains in Los Angeles County, California. It is within the Angeles National Forest.The lake is one of a series of sag ponds in the area, including Elizabeth Lake and Hughes Lake, all created by active tectonic plate movement. The lake receives its name from rancher John Munz, who arrived to the area in 1898.".
